John you will find a different combination of medication recommended
by every person with PD. What works for one does not always work for
someone else.
Stalevo is two pills combined in one; Sinemet and Comtan.
I was diagnosed in 1994 at age 42. My meds for about the last 15 years
has been Sinemet CR 200/50 four tablets per day. This worked fine but
gradually my symptoms became worse until about 4 months ago when I had
to use a walking frame to get along in shopping malls. I increased my
Sinemet to 5 daily, but this increased my dyskinesias significantly! I
tried Comtan with my Sinemet CR and didn't notice any difference to my
condition. I tried Eldepryl and later, Azilect, and they made me feel
irritable and thickheaded. The only difference I noticed was in my
online Chess games. I started loosing more!
Then I tried Symmetrel (Amantidine), and was reborn!
Suddenly I can wash and dry myself, cut my own food, walk without a
frame, type, effortlessly turn around at night, etc. etc.
I now take a Symmetrel and SinemetCR(200/50) at 7am. SinemetCR at
noon. Symmetrel at 14h00. SinemetCR at 17h00, and a SinemetCR at
22h00.
Good luck and have fun experimenting;-)

> I was diagnosed with PD in 2005. Im currently 67 and active. I take Sinemet  3 x day
> /     2 tabs each time.
> My Neuro is thinking that either Azilect (rasagiline)  or  Comtan (also known as Stalevo) might help me with some of my symptoms.
> My symptoms are the usual// /tremor/gait/stiffness/fatigue etc.
>
> My question is: what, if any, experiences have you had with one or the other medication
> I would appreciate any feedback that you might have.
>
> I have read the effect/side effects listed and would like to hear from those that have taken the med.
> Thank you for your time and help.
